- The distance between Princess Anne, Md, Usa and Salyan, Azerbaijan is approximately 9,726 km or 6,044 mi.
- To reach Princess Anne, Md in this distance one would set out from Salyan bearing 319.7° or NW and follow the great circles arc to approach Princess Anne, Md bearing 219.2° or SW .
- Princess Anne, Md has a humid subtropical climate (Cfa) whereas Salyan has a Mediterranean hot climate (Csa).
- Princess Anne, Md is in or near the warm temperate moist forest biome whereas Salyan is in or near the warm temperate dry forest biome.
- The average annual temperature is 0.5 °C (0.9°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 3 °C (5.4°F) more in Princess Anne, Md. The continentality subtype is subcontinental as opposed to semicontinental.
- Total annual precipitation averages 786.9 mm (31 in) more which is equivalent to 786.9 l/m² (19.31 US gal/ft²) or 7,869,000 l/ha (841,248 US gal/ac) more. About 3 5/8 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 1.6° higher in Princess Anne, Md than in Salyan.
